    The 2024 Mitsubishi Triton started selling this year in the Philippines, and in this Filipino car review, we take the 2024 Mitsubishi Triton GLS out for a weeklong drive to see if it performs better than before. The 2024 Mitsubishi Triton GLS is the top-spec 4x2 Triton in the Philippines, since we still don't get the 2024 Mitsubishi Triton Athlete 4x2 here in the Philippines. In this video, I got to drive the 2024 Mitsubishi Triton GLS out of the city to see how well it performs on the highway and with a full load of passengers and gear. The 2024 Mitsubishi Triton GLS price is quite affordable for the features and performance you get, making it a solid contender in the midsize pick up truck segment. The 2024 Mitsubishi Triton also replaced the Mitsubishi Strada from before, which now streamlines the naming of the Mitsubishi Strada with the global name of the Mitsubishi Triton.
